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Westernport, MD

Considering a move to Westernport, MD? This small town of 1,669 people offers affordable living with a median home price of just $82,500 and average rent around $600. Residents enjoy a relaxed pace, reasonable commute times under 25 minutes, and access to local schools and healthcare. The town sees low violent crime rates (190 per 100K), four true seasons, and a tight-knit community feel—a great fit for those seeking small-town charm at a budget-friendly cost.

Is Westernport, MD a safe place to live?

Westernport experiences a low violent crime rate of 190 incidents per 100,000 people, offering residents a sense of safety. The chance of being a victim of violent crime is 1 in 525, while property crimes are somewhat more common but still manageable for a small town. Overall, the crime index suggests a relatively secure environment.

What is the weather like in Westernport, MD year-round?

Residents of Westernport enjoy four true seasons, with warm summers reaching up to 83°F and cold winters dipping to 22°F. The town receives about 41.5 inches of rainfall annually and sees sunshine roughly 52% of the year. These climate conditions offer a balance of seasonal variety and outdoor opportunities.

What is the housing market like in Westernport, MD?

Westernport’s housing market is characterized by affordability, with a median home price of $82,500 and average two-bedroom rents around $600. About two-thirds of homes are owner-occupied, and the area has seen a recent home appreciation rate of 5.2%. Rental vacancies remain higher than average, offering options for both buyers and renters.
